§ 3051. Legislative findings and statement of purposes. The\nlegislature hereby finds and declares that it is necessary for a\nmunicipal assistance corporation to be created to assist the city of\nTroy in providing essential services to its inhabitants without\ninterruption and in creating investor confidence in the soundness of the\nobligations of such city so that it may retain its ability to sell its\nobligations to the public.\n The legislature further finds that it is in the interest of the state\nof New York and the city of Troy that certain capital programs of the\ncity of Troy be funded, and certain cumulative deficits of the city of\nTroy be liquidated, with the proceeds of debt obligations, including\nsecurities of the municipal assistance corporation for the city of Troy.\n
